Method for manufacturing eco-friendly antibacterial coated paper

1. A method for manufacturing an eco-friendly antibacterial polymer-coated paper, the method comprising:
mixing 40 to 50% by weight of a mixture of methyl methacrylate and butyl acrylate as acrylic monomers in a weight ratio of 1:4 to 4:1, 0.5 to 3.0% by weight of a copper nanopowder, 0.5 to 2.0% by weight of an initiator, 1 to 5% by weight of a polymeric dispersant, and a balance of water to prepare a mixed solution;
stirring the mixed solution at 70 to 80° C. for 5 to 10 hours for polymerizing the mixture and thereby forming a polymeric coating agent; and
coating the polymeric coating agent to a thickness of 5 to 10 μm on a paper and drying the polymeric coating agent.
